Levante UD host CA Osasuna on matchday 26 of the Liga BBVA. Joaquín Caparrós' team will be looking to pick up some more points in order to draw nearer to the European spots while the team from Navarre are aiming to stay up.
The home side is firing on all cylinders at the moment after seven weeks unbeaten, with four draws and three victories. In addition, the Sevillian coach is not missing any players for the match, therefore he has had to leave out Miguel Pallardó, Héctor Rodas, Pedro Ríos, El Adoua, Nagore and Jordi Xumetra. "Osasuna are really on their game, therefore we will have to play with great intensity and concentration", stated Caparrós.
Meanwhile, morale is high at Osasuna after a solid performance against Club Atlético de Madrid, who they beat 3-0 last week. Despite the fact that Javi Gracia will have to make do without the injured Patxi Puñal, Marc Bertrán, Sisi and Miguel de las Cuevas, the rojillos' manager spoke of his team's hard work: "We have prepared not to give much away. We are well aware of what is at stake".
